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  • What separates the high-performance iPF780 MFP M40 configuration from basic standalone printer frameworks?
    The imagePROGRAF iPF780 MFP M40 is a unified print, copy, scan, and archive station configured for highly collaborative technical departments. By mounting the heavy-duty M40 SingleSensor scanner block and an independent multi-touch monitor dashboard directly above the printer frame, you eliminate the need for third-party workstation nodes. It handles complex, high-resolution document processing at up to 1200 dpi and scans rigid media boards up to 2 mm thick, such as mounted field charts.
  • What advantages does the iPF780 foundation offer over older models like the iPF770 MFP M40?
    The iPF780 generation features a significantly faster internal engine architecture that drives down print times, outputting a standard A1 sheet in just 21 seconds (compared to 25 seconds on older layouts). Furthermore, it is designed to support the ultra-high-capacity 300 ml (PFI-207) ink containers across all five tank slots, minimizing user maintenance intervals during massive project distributions.
  • What are the benefits of this 5-color reactive ink setup for blueprints and technical maps?
    The system utilizes a specialized layout that pairs dye color inks with premium matte black pigment ink. When printing fine technical line drawings or GIS charts, a chemical reaction occurs that instantly binds the inks together. This locks crisp lines into place, avoiding bleeding and ensuring excellent water and smudge resistance on standard technical bonds.
